The Quality Engineer is responsible for establishing implementing and maintaining quality standards for products and processes within the manufacturing environment. This role involves identifying opportunities to prevent defects collaborating with crossfunctional teams performing audits conducting root cause analysis and ensuring compliance with both internal and external quality standards.

About MacLeanFogg
At MacLeanFogg youll be part of a global manufacturing leader with a 100year legacy of innovation and excellence. We partner with some of the worlds most iconic brands to create highquality fasteners components and engineered solutions for industries that shape the future. With the recent addition of Mallard Manufacturing weve expanded into industryleading gravity flow solutions for material handling.
